City of Allen is seeking a Swim Instructor to assist in conducting the City Swim School programs and provide excellent customer service to participants and families. The role focuses on safety, instruction across age groups, and coordination with other city staff.CPR/AED certification is required or must be obtained within 30 days of hire.
The position offers varied shifts including afternoons, evenings, and weekends, with pay per hour in the listed range.

Under direct supervision, assists in conducting the City of Allen Swim School programs. Other duties may include providing customer service and interfacing with other City employees and citizens. This position does not provide direction to other employees.
